Frequently Asked Questions
Which AI platform is best for SEO?
Perplexity is currently most SEO-friendly because it cites sources inline with visible links, making traffic and conversions trackable. ChatGPT has the largest audience but citations are less visible. Claude excels for authoritative, research-heavy content. Most brands should optimize for all three.
How does each platform cite content differently?
ChatGPT shows sources in a side panel (less visible, fewer clicks). Perplexity cites inline with numbered references (highly visible, drives traffic). Claude provides direct quotes with attribution when search is enabled. These differences significantly impact how you measure and optimize for each.
Can I track ROI from AI citations?
Perplexity offers the clearest tracking—inline citations drive measurable referral traffic. ChatGPT ROI is harder to measure (brand lift, indirect traffic). Claude falls in between. Use UTM parameters, monitor referrer data, and track brand search volume lifts to estimate overall AI-driven impact.
What content works best for each platform?
ChatGPT: structured content with schema markup, E-E-A-T signals, FAQ format. Perplexity: stat-rich explainers, comparison content, quotable facts. Claude: deep technical content, methodology-focused writing, evergreen authority pieces. Match content format to platform strengths.
How do I test my visibility across platforms?
Run the same prompts across all three platforms monthly. Document which cite you, for which queries, with what sentiment. Use tools like Otterly for automated monitoring. Track changes over time as you optimize. Compare your share of voice to competitors.
Should I prioritize ChatGPT because it's biggest?
Not necessarily. ChatGPT's size means more competition and less visible citations. Perplexity's smaller but more engaged audience with clear citation links may drive better ROI. Consider your goals: brand awareness (ChatGPT), measurable traffic (Perplexity), or authority building (Claude).
